About this company

Pristine Clean and Restoration is a locally owned restoration and cleaning company headquartered in Auburn Hills, Michigan. They started as a carpet cleaning operation and expanded into mold work, water damage, fire damage, and biohazard cleanup. Owner Elvir runs the business directly and shows up on job sites for inspections and estimates. The company holds IICRC certification and advertises a 24/7 emergency response line.

What stands out is the breadth of services under one small company. They do their own mold testing with lab analysis (quoted at $300-$700 on their website), then handle remediation if needed. Their mold process includes isolating affected areas with plastic sheeting and negative air pressure, removing damaged materials, applying antimicrobial treatments, and drying with dehumidifiers and air movers. They also do carpet cleaning, upholstery cleaning, tile and grout work, and boat and RV cleaning.

The company claims 15 years of experience and serves the tri-county Metro Detroit area covering Macomb, Wayne, and Oakland counties. Reviews confirm commercial clients use them too, including a 700-unit property manager and an animal hospital.

Pattern worth noting

Both complaints target the office and scheduling experience, not the field crews or the quality of work. This is a common pattern in owner-operated restoration companies where the owner (Elvir) gets strong personal reviews but the office staff handling intake and billing does not match that standard. Keep in mind

  • They do both mold testing and mold remediation. A company that tests for mold and then sells the remediation has a financial incentive to find problems. Consider getting a second opinion on the test results from an independent inspector before committing to a large remediation job.
